Object detection apparatus
First Claim
1. An object detection apparatus for detecting the states of an eye of an operator, said object detection device comprising:
- a light emission device which includes at least two emitters for selectively operating either one of said emitters for emitting light at a visible wavelength of approximately 0.76 μ
m with nearly no sunlight disturbance or a non-visible light wavelength of approximately 0.94 μ
m with nearly no sunlight disturbance, to the eye of the operator;
a camera which includes a light reception device for receiving reflected light from the eye of the operator;
a filter for allowing light to pass through at the wavelength; and
an image processor for analyzing the filtered light to determine the state of the eye of the operator.

Abstract
Provided is an object detection apparatus, which includes a light emission device irradiating an object with light at a wavelength having less disturbance, and a light reception device including a filter that permits light having the aforementioned wavelength to pass, for receiving reflected light from the object. When the disturbance is sunlight, the light having a wavelength whereat the spectral radiative illuminance is damped is employed in accordance with the spectral characteristic of sunlight. In one embodiment, an object detection apparatus, which is mounted in a vehicle, employs, as an object, the eyes of a crew member in the vehicle, and obtains reflected images of the crew member'"'"'s corneas and retinas to calculate the observed point viewed by the crew member.
